Where is Houxiang?
Where is Houxiang located?
Houxiang, Jiangsu, China (approx. 32.11667°, 119.7667°)
Where is Houxiang on the map?
Houxiang - Tangshan
Houxiang - Yufan
Houxiang - Отель Long Wish Hotel International
Houxiang - Peachen
{"latitude":32.11667,"longitude":119.7667,"title":"Houxiang"}